NA Chairman underlines importance of legislative studies

Legislative studies should serve facilitation of development, and help remove problems and shortcomings of the current legal system, National Assembly Chairman Vuong Dinh Hue said on June 22.

Hanoi (VNA) – Legislative studies shouldserve facilitation of development, and help remove problems and shortcomings of thecurrent legal system, National Assembly Chairman Vuong Dinh Hue said on June22.

During a working session with the Institute for LegislativeStudies, Hue said since its inception 13 years ago, the institute has madeefforts to complete tasks regarding legislative scientific research and publish the Legislative Studies Journal.

Hue urged the institute to play a more active role in researching and making recommendations on how to concretise theParty’s guidelines in the resolution adopted at the 13th NationalParty Congress, particularly new issues raised in the document. 
Another task for the institute is to review and perfect the existing legal system, he said, stressing the Politburo’s requirements of buildinga unified, synchronous, transparent, stable and highly feasible legal system,and asked the institute to take them into account.

To raise its operational efficiency, the instituteshould quickly draw up a project to revamp its operation, Hue said, noting thatinformation products must be digitalised to make it easier for users./.
